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kingham to Hairmyres start from as little as £65.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kingham to Hairmyres start from £139.00 one way, or £198.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kingham to Hairmyres are available for £143.10 one way, or £286.20 return

Facilities at Kingham Station

For ease of travel, Kingham Station has a ticket office open from the early hours on weekdays and Saturday, complemented by ticket machines and accessible options for those using smartcards. While the station might lack in the array of shops or ATMs, it ensures your journey stays smooth with essential refreshment facilities. Public payphones are available, though Wi-Fi is not provided. Despite the absence of a structured waiting room, sufficient seating areas ensure comfort while you wait for your train.

Step-free access is present but somewhat limited, as platform 2 is only reachable by a step bridge. Assistance for passengers with reduced mobility is available, and ramps for train access make the station inclusive for everyone. Booking your assistance up to two hours in advance is recommended, which can be done online for a hassle-free experience.

Parking, Cycling, and Refreshments

Your parking needs are catered to with 140 spaces in the station's car park, operating 24 hours across the week under APCOA Parking. Though the parking accommodation does not offer designated accessible spaces, blue badge holders are exempted from charges. For cyclists, Kingham offers storage for up to six cycles with secure stands and CCTV surveillance, ensuring your bicycle remains safe.

Transport Links from Kingham

Kingham Station seamlessly integrates various transport options for your onward journey. Rail replacement services are conveniently located in front of the station building for those times when train travel isn’t possible. For broader connectivity, plan your bus trips using the printable guide from the National Rail website. Air travel links are excellently handled by changing trains at Reading for Heathrow and Gatwick, or at Bristol Temple Meads for Bristol Airport.

Station Facilities: Essential Information for Travelers

Although Hairmyres station does not have a ticket office, it is equipped with ticket machines that facilitate the collection of pre-purchased tickets, with accessible options available for all passengers. The presence of smartcard validators also brings a modern convenience, ensuring a seamless travel experience. However, keep in mind that the station does not issue smartcards. When considering safety and support, CCTV cameras are in place throughout the station, adding an extra layer of security for travelers.

For accessibility, Hairmyres scores well with step-free access throughout the station, including designated blue badge parking bays. Yet, certain limitations exist such as the absence of ramps for train access, accessible toilets, and a lack of onsite wheelchairs. It's essential to take extra caution when stepping on or off trains, as the gap between the train and platform might be more pronounced here.

Onward Travel and Connections

Travelers at Hairmyres are well-served by several transport options beyond the train. Bus services are frequent, with pick-up and drop-off points located conveniently on the main road outside the car park. For precise bus stop locations, What3Words provides exact points, making navigation straightforward. Taxi services can be accessed through TrainTaxi, ensuring that visitors can reach their final destination seamlessly.

Cycling enthusiasts will be pleased to find bicycle storage and hire facilities available, with lockers and stands provided, albeit without CCTV protection. CycleLane offers hire services should you wish to explore the scenic routes at your own pace.
